Overview
We are seeking a proven wind industry leader to oversee field operations and infrastructure support for wind turbine technicians across multiple wind farms and renewable energy sites. This role is ideal for someone who has spent their career in wind energy operations and understands the day-to-day challenges of maintaining turbine fleets, supporting traveling technician crews, and ensuring safe, efficient execution of field activities. The Program Manager will serve as the bridge between field operations, technician teams, client stakeholders, and internal support functions. Success in this role requires deep knowledge of wind turbine operations, technician deployment, site logistics, safety compliance, and workforce management within a fast-paced renewable energy environment.
Key Responsibilities
Lead operational support programs for wind turbine technicians across multiple wind projects and customer sitesManage and develop teams responsible for technician scheduling, travel coordination, site readiness, and workforce deploymentPartner closely with Site Managers, Lead Technicians, and Field Service teams to ensure efficient turbine maintenance and service executionOversee technician mobilization, certifications, training compliance, PPE management, tooling requirements, and field logisticsServe as the primary escalation point for turbine service issues, operational constraints, workforce challenges, and customer concernsDrive workforce planning initiatives to ensure proper technician coverage during outages, scheduled maintenance campaigns, commissioning projects, and major component exchangesTrack operational KPIs including technician utilization, safety performance, mobilization timelines, project completion metrics, and customer satisfactionEstablish and improve operational processes that enhance technician efficiency, site support, and service delivery performanceBuild strong relationships with wind farm operators, OEM partners, EPC organizations, and internal stakeholdersSupport continuous improvement initiatives focused on turbine uptime, operational excellence, and field service scalability
Required Qualifications
7+ years of experience within the wind energy industryPrior experience as a Wind Site Manager, Operations Manager, Regional Service Manager, Field Service Manager, Program Manager, or similar leadership role supporting wind turbine operationsDemonstrated experience managing wind turbine technicians, field service personnel, or traveling renewable energy crewsStrong understanding of wind turbine maintenance activities, major component exchanges, commissioning, troubleshooting, and field operationsExperience supporting utility-scale wind projects and multi-site technician deployment programsKnowledge of wind industry safety requirements, technician certifications, and training standards including GWO programsProven leadership experience managing both people and operational executionStrong customer relationship management and stakeholder communication skillsAbility to manage multiple sites, competing priorities, and large-scale field operations simultaneously
Preferred Qualifications
Experience working with major wind OEMs such as GE Vernova, Vestas, Siemens Gamesa, Nordex, or EnerconPMP certification or equivalent project/program management credentialsPrevious oversight of large technician networks supporting utility-scale wind portfoliosExperience managing operational budgets, workforce forecasting, and service delivery financialsBackground in field service operations, renewable energy logistics, or wind farm asset management
